Detailed analysis of the Skoda Octavia Laurin&Klement 1.8 TSI 160 CV (2010-2012)
General description
The 2009 Skoda Octavia Laurin&Klement 1.8 TSI is a sedan that, beneath its discreet appearance, hides a powerful engine and luxurious equipment. With 160 HP, this Octavia offers a combination of performance and comfort that makes it stand out in its segment, ideal for those looking for a practical car with a touch of distinction.
Driving experience
Behind the wheel, the Octavia Laurin&Klement 1.8 TSI conveys a sense of solidity and poise. Its 160 HP engine responds energetically from low revolutions, offering 0 to 100 km/h acceleration in 7.8 seconds and a top speed of 223 km/h. The suspension, McPherson type at the front and deformable parallelogram at the rear, filters road irregularities well, providing a comfortable ride without sacrificing stability. The rack-and-pinion steering with electric assistance is precise, though not overly communicative, and the ventilated front disc brakes and rear discs offer safe stopping. It's a car that invites travel, with predictable handling and agile response when demanded.

Technology and features
Despite being a 2009 model, the Octavia Laurin&Klement 1.8 TSI incorporates advanced technology for its time. Its 1.8 TSI direct injection, turbo, and intercooler engine is an example of efficiency and performance. The 6-speed manual transmission allows maximum utilization of engine power. In terms of safety, it features ABS brakes and stability control. Comfort equipment includes elements such as automatic climate control, a quality sound system, and electrically adjustable seats, which contribute to a pleasant driving experience. Although it does not have the latest current driving aids, its technology focuses on reliability and functionality.
Competition
At the time, the Skoda Octavia Laurin&Klement 1.8 TSI competed with mid-size sedans such as the Volkswagen Jetta, the Ford Focus Sedan, or the Opel Astra Sedan. Its main advantage lay in offering superior interior and trunk space, along with a powerful engine and luxurious equipment at a very competitive price. Its value for money made it a very attractive alternative to models from more premium brands, offering similar performance with a more adjusted acquisition and maintenance cost.
